What is not Leadership ?

Play Episode Listen Later Dec 20, 2020 90:41


We know what Leadership is; In-fact, we are being told at every turn. What is not leadership however is less discussed and this action are stuck in the subconscious of many - thinking leaders are made and not born. If we have it at the back of our minds that we are a born leader we will be willing to take the lead and take up leadership positions. The myth of leadership creates a rank-based culture where the leaders possess special privilege to speak and the followers possess an unreciprocated obligation to listen; where the leaders are entitled to monopolize information, control decision-making, and command obedience, thus establishing a culture of secrecy and limitations. Listen and unlearn subconsciously what is not leadership to birth a new style of leadership.
